The under-tack preview show for the Ocala Breeders' Sales Co.'s March sale of 2-year-olds in training concluded Friday with colts by Good Magic and Not This Time sharing the bullet work. The two colts each breezed a furlong, the traditional measuring stick for juvenile sales, in 9 3/5 seconds on the Ocala Training Center's all-weather Safetrack surface. The four-day breeze show, from Tuesday to Friday, precedes next week's sale, which takes place over three sessions from Monday to Wednesday to kick off the 2-year-old sale season in North America. The Kentucky-bred Good Magic colt turned in his work during Thursday's breeze show session to climb atop the leaderboard. Breeders’ Cup Juvenile winner and Eclipse Award champion Good Magic was last year’s second-leading freshman sire by earnings, and is the sire of Grade 1-winner Blazing Sevens, graded stakes winners Curly Jack, Dubyuhnell, Reincarnate, Vegas Magic, and stakes winners Bat Flip and How Did He Do That. His bullet-working colt, consigned by Top Line Sales, as agent, is out of the winning Uncle Mo mare Hoppa. Grade 1-Group 1 winners Hit the Road, Rollout the Carpet, and War Command appear on the catalog page. The Not This Time colt matched that time in Friday's under-tack session for consignor GOP Racing Stable Corp. Not This Time was a top-10 sire in 2022, with runners led by Grade 1 winner and Eclipse Award champion Epicenter. His bullet worker is an Iowa-bred out of the stakes-winning Runaway Groom mare Meadow Bride. She is the dam of stakes-placed Bridgette Bordeaux. Out of the smaller group of juveniles to work a quarter-mile, a colt by Bucchero and a filly by Enticed shared the fastest time, each working in 20 3/5 seconds. The colt, a Florida-bred from the second crop of the state sire Bucchero, is out of the winning Utopia mare Cynthia's Fury, whose first starter is stakes winner My Sassenach. He is consigned by Tom McCrocklin, as agent. This is the first crop for Enticed, a multiple graded stakes winner. His bullet-working filly, a California-bred, is out of the winning Tapit mare Love's Illusion, dam of stakes-placed J C's a Legend. The filly is consigned by Omar Ramirez Bloodstock, as agent.
